Subject: Re: [PATCH] ovl: filter of trusted xattr results in audit

On Mon, Oct 07, 2019 at 09:09:16AM -0700, Mark Salyzyn wrote:
> When filtering xattr list for reading, presence of trusted xattr
> results in a security audit log.  However, if there is other content
> no errno will be set, and if there isn't, the errno will be -ENODATA
> and not -EPERM as is usually associated with a lack of capability.
> The check does not block the request to list the xattrs present.
> 
> Switch to has_capability_noaudit to reflect a more appropriate check.
